    Bunk beds are a fun and space-saving way to add a sleeping area to your child's room. They're also great for sleepovers or for families with multiple children sharing bedrooms.

    When buying bunk beds you should consider the material, size and style. Be aware of the age of your children and the way they'll use it.

    Size

    A bunk bed can be an ideal solution to save space in a small area. They also offer more space for sleeping for several children or guests, and are a fun option for kids who love to play.

    Bunk beds come in a wide range of sizes and styles, so you can find one that is perfect for your family. A few of the most popular choices are twin-over-twin and twin-overfull queen-overqueen beds. You can find bunk beds in a broad range of colors and finishes.

    It is essential to assess the space before choosing a bunk bed. Be aware of the height of the ceiling and the floor space. You'll also need to know the weight and age of the people who will be using it.

    Ideally, the top bunk should be situated between 33 and 36 inches away from the ceiling to ensure security. This is especially important for children who are tall or have to accommodate adults while they sleep.

    Another important aspect to think about is the mattress's size. There are numerous bunk bed mattresses to choose from that include cooling gel memory foam, hybrid and traditional mattresses.

    For the bottom bunk the best bunk beds option is to use a low-profile mattress. You don't want the mattress to be too heavy to put strain on your bunk bed frame however, you do not have to make it so heavy that a sleeper could be thrown off.

    It is important to consider the thickness of the mattress for the safety and comfort of the sleepers. A bottom bunk mattress is usually 8 to 10 inches thick.

    The ideal mattress for a bunk bed should have a comfort layer of at approximately 2 inches in thickness and a foundation at minimum 6 inches thick. It must be thick enough that there is enough space between the mattress and top bunk beds children's to allow the sleeper to lie upright while sleeping.

    Other important things to remember when shopping for bunk beds are the weight limit as well as the size of the ladder and mattress thickness. These factors will make a big difference in how comfortable and secure your bunk bed is.

    Style

    Whether you're furnishing the bedroom of a shared space or renovating a guest space, bunk beds could be the answer to many of your space problems. They're versatile and can be made to meet your requirements.

    They can also be used to create extra sleeping areas in cabins, vacation homes, or even small apartments. The key is to choose the right bunk bed arrangement that fits with your home's layout and allows for all of your sleeping needs, without losing any space.

    Some bunk beds are positioned so that the top bunk could be accessed via stairs instead of the ladder. This is an excellent option for children who aren't strong enough to climb ladders or do not understand the idea of safety.

    Another popular bunk bed layout is the L-shape. This makes a small alcove which is perfect for bookshelf or a desk, and also makes a practical choice for those who live in smaller homes or apartments.

    You can choose from a wide range of colors and styles for an L-shaped bed, such as wood or metal. These bunks are often fitted with desks.

    A desk that is well-designed can serve as a place to do homework or other classes, and it helps create the perfect reading area for children. The desk can also be used as a storage space for books. It can also be combined with the computer chair and projector for a great movie night set-up.

    Many people believe that bunk beds are twin beds that stack one on top of the other. But, they are able to be configured with an additional trundle in the bottom. These bunks are especially useful for guests as well as older teens who want to share a room with their family or friends.

    These bunks are available in a variety of materials such as reclaimed wood and solid wood. They're also available in various shades, from a creamy French White to the brushed Gray. They can add a touch rustic style to a modern or modern kids' room, or even be paired with furniture that is rustic style.

    Materials

    Bunk beds are a stylish practical solution for a bedroom. There are numerous options for styles, materials, and configurations, so you should think about your personal preferences before purchasing bunk beds.

    The material used to make the bunk bed can be an important factor in the way it appears and feels in the bedroom, as well as its durability. Based on your preferences you can select bunk beds that are made of metal or wood or a combination of both.

    Wood bunk beds give a natural, warm feeling and are generally more appealing than metal alternatives. They are also less likely to be damaged than a metal bunk beds, which makes them more durable over time.

    They're also less expensive than their metal counterparts and are available in a wide variety of colors, shapes and styles. This makes them a great option for families with kids of different preferences.

    Some bunk beds come with drawers that can be used for storage. This is a great way to keep extra items in the bedroom. They can be set beneath the top bunk or they can be integrated in the headboard unit of the bunk.

    Shelves are another fantastic storage option. They can be put into the headboard of the top bunk, or placed on the wall to create a stylish space that is easy for children to access.

    When it comes to security, be sure to get a bunk bed that is designed to accommodate your children's height and age, so they're not in danger of falling off the top. You should also pick bunk beds that fit with the style of your room.

    You could also find bunk beds that have distinctive features, like tents or slides. This can be a fun method for children to turn the bunk beds into a miniature indoor playground. The tents could have different styles, designs and patterns which will spark their imaginations and help transform the room into an indoor play space.

    Storage

    Bunk beds with built-in drawers and closets may maximize space in a tiny room or shared kid's room. Lofts and bunks come in a variety of designs and finishes, and there are many options to add extra storage to the bed - from under-bed drawers to shoe organizers.

    The most popular way to create storage in a bunk bed is with the pull-out drawer. They are ideal for storing many things such as books and toys. They are accessible when it's time to get dressed in the morning.

    Another option for added storage is the bunk bed shelf. This simple, low-cost option can be used to store extra items and a place to hang small objects like towels, clothes or other small objects that cannot be hung on the bed.

    Bunk bed shelves are great for parents who have young children, because they make it much easier to store a child's belongings on top of the bunk while parents are still available to assist those who need help. Furthermore they can also be an ornamental feature that can add a touch of style to the room.

    If you have a young child, they'll like to read or study in their bedroom. You can find bunk beds that come with desks or study lofts that provide a safe, supervised learning space.

    If you have a huge room, a bunk bed with stairs can be extremely useful. This model has the option of a side-loaded and front-loaded drawers that offer additional storage space as well as easy and secure access the upper bed.

    There are many styles and finishes available for these bunk beds that have storage steps. Therefore, there's something to fit everyone's preferences. Some are made of wood while others are designed to look like an ordinary daybed, with an L-shaped arrangement.

    If you're considering a bunk bed with storage, think about the size of the room and whether it will be used as an individual bed or a double. Also, take into consideration the weight and age of the individual sleeping on it as in addition to any special needs.
